
Royals Complete Trade with Blades
Published on September 12, 2018 under Western Hockey League (WHL)
Victoria Royals News Release
Victoria, BC - The Victoria Royals are pleased to announce that the club has acquired 2001-born forward Logan Doust from the Saskatoon Blades in exchange for a ninth round pick in the 2020 WHL Bantam Draft and a conditional pick in 2020.
The North Vancouver, BC product, played the majority of last season in the BC Major Midget Hockey League (BCMML) with the Vancouver Northwest Giants. In 20 games with the Northwest Giants, Doust recorded 16 points (6g-10a) and 20 penalty minutes. He also played in three games with Saskatoon.
During the 2016-17 season, the 6-0, 178 lb forward registered 13 goals and 13 assists in 26 games for Vancouver (BCMML).
The 17-year-old was selected by Saskatoon in the ninth round, 198th overall, in the 2016 WHL Bantam Draft.
